Product Overview
- The product is an online water-quality analyzer from BOQU Instrument (model TNG-3020) designed for automatic, continuous monitoring of total nitrogen (TN) in water.
- It uses resorcinol spectrophotometry and requires no sample pretreatment: the probe/sample riser can be inserted directly into the measured stream.
- Measurement capability covers three ranges (0–10, 0.5–100, 5–500 mg/L TN) with high sensitivity (±0.05 mg/L for values ≤0.5 mg/L) and repeatability ≤±5%.
- Built for industrial and environmental monitoring with touch-screen operation, data retention on alarms/power loss, and standard outputs (4–20 mA, RS232/RS485).
Product Features
- Eco-friendly construction and factory-level quality control to ensure reliable performance.
- Precise reagent dosing via a visible photoelectric metering system (trace doses ≈1.5 ml), reducing quantitative errors from peristaltic pump wear.
- Select valve assembly for controlled reagent/sample timing and a negative-pressure peristaltic injection design that protects pump tubing.
- Sealed high-temperature, high-pressure digestion module for faster, safer reactions and reduced gas volatilization/corrosion.
- Durable PTFE transparent reagent tubing (≥1.5 mm ID) to minimize clogging; configurable digestion time (5–120 min) and sampling/calibration intervals.
